Vitamins and Minerals. Pumpernickel bread is an excellent source of manganese, a mineral used in the body to maintain strong bones, healthy reproduction, blood clotting, and a strong immune system. 3. Pumpernickel is also a good source of selenium, providing about 7.8 micrograms per slice.
According to the USDA National Nutrient Database, one slice of pumpernickel bread contains 3.00 g of protein, 0.50 g of total fat, 14.00 g of carbohydrate and 1.00 g of fiber. Pumpernickel is also cholesterol free and low in fat, with one slice containing a diet-friendly 70 calories — less than the amount found in an apple.Although it sometimes tastes slightly sweet, it is recommended to prevent diabetes.
